ORCA Quest 2 Monochrome Camera Hamamatsu

The ORCA-Quest 2 is a latest-generation qCMOS scientific camera with photon number resolution (PNR) capability, very low readout noise and high sensitivity, particularly in the UV range.

This camera is designed for applications requiring extremely accurate detection in very low light.

Description of the Hamamatsu ORCA Quest 2 monochrome camera

  • Ultra-low read noise: 0.30 e- rms (Ultra quiet scan)
  • Photoelectron number resolution (PNR)
  • High-sensitivity back-illuminated sensor (4.6 µm)
  • High quantum efficiency, including UV
  • High acquisition speed: up to 120 fps
  • Multiple readout modes: Standard scan, Ultra quiet scan
  • External trigger and C-mount optical compatibility

Technical specifications of the Hamamatsu ORCA Quest 2 monochrome camera

Caractéristique Valeur
Sensor / Type Quantitative qCMOS (qCMOS)
Resolution 4096 × 2304 pixels (9.4 MP)
Pixel size 4.6 µm × 4.6 µm
Playback noise 0.30 e- rms (UQ scan) / 0.43 e- rms (Standard)
Acquisition speed Up to 120 fps (full resolution)
Dark current Very low – optimised low light
Sensor structure Back-illuminated with pixel-by-pixel isolation
Reading modes Area, Lightsheet, Photon-number resolving
Frame C-mount

Applications

  • Very low-light scientific imaging
  • Fluorescence and bioluminescence microscopy
  • Super-resolution microscopy
  • Photonics, physics and astronomy research
  • Spectroscopy and sensitive quantitative measurements
